Bible Teacher Clay Scroggins talks about how everyone wants to be great. But Jesus flips our definition of greatness by teaching that power isn’t for elevating ourselves—it’s for serving others and giving our lives away for their good. True greatness is seen in Christ, who had all authority yet chose the cross, showing that real leadership is not about status, but sacrifice.
